Education has come a long way from chalk and blackboards. Now, the vanguard of educational innovation is the LCD Interactive Smart Board.

In today's burgeoning technology era, LCD Smart Boards are making massive impacts in classrooms and businesses across the globe.

They are essentially interactive displays that connect to a projector and a computer. These boards use LCD (Liquid Crystal Display) technology to display images, text, and videos.

With a Smart Board, students and teachers can interact with the material, creating a more immersive learning experience.

Their multi-touch capabilities mean that several users can engage with the board all at once, fostering a sense of cooperation and collaboration.

LCD Interactive Smart Boards Not only do these boards provide a larger display, but they also come equipped with features and tools such as writing, highlighting, and a search engine.

Several educators swear by these boards for their transformative effects on teaching and learning. The improved levels of student participation and engagement are commonly attributed to the interactivity that these boards offer.

LCD Smart Boards Besides classrooms, businesses regularly utilize these boards to invigorate meetings and presentations. Presenters can interact with their presentation content, illustrate ideas directly, and save annotations for future reference.

While new technology can sometimes be intimidating, the LCD Smart Board is user-friendly.
